On 9th January 2026, Jaipuria Institute of Management, Lucknow conducted an insightful and engaging session titled “Managing Stress & Anxiety – Finding Calm in a Hyper-Connected World.” The session was led by Dr. Prabhat Pankaj, Director – Academics, as part of the Institute’s continued focus on holistic academic and personal development.
The session provided practical and evidence-based insights into understanding stress and anxiety through interactive discussions, real-life illustrations, and perspectives drawn from neuroscience. Emphasis was placed on mindful thinking, emotional awareness, and the cultivation of healthy cognitive and behavioral responses in an increasingly digital and fast-paced environment.
Managing stress and anxiety is critical for sustaining mental well-being, enhancing focus, and improving decision-making, particularly in high-pressure academic and professional settings. Effective stress management enables individuals to build emotional resilience, maintain productivity, and foster balanced interpersonal relationships. In today’s hyper-connected world, developing the ability to disconnect, reflect, and respond thoughtfully has become an essential life skill, contributing significantly to long-term personal and professional success.
